Decoding the E-commerce Marketing Manager Role

Duties and Responsibilities of E-commerce Marketing Manager

An e-commerce marketing manager is a crucial player in a company’s digital strategy, directly impacting online sales and brand presence. You will be responsible for overseeing all aspects of digital marketing efforts. This includes planning, execution, and optimization.

You typically manage various marketing channels like seo, sem, social media, email marketing, and content marketing. Furthermore, you analyze market trends and customer data to identify new opportunities. You then develop effective strategies based on these insights.

Your role also involves setting key performance indicators (KPIs) and tracking campaign performance rigorously. You use analytics tools to measure roi and make data-backed adjustments. This ensures continuous improvement across all initiatives.

Moreover, you often collaborate closely with product development, sales, and IT teams. This cross-functional teamwork ensures a seamless customer journey. You align marketing efforts with overall business objectives.

Ultimately, an e-commerce marketing manager aims to increase website traffic, improve conversion rates, and enhance customer lifetime value. You also build strong brand awareness and foster customer loyalty. This contributes significantly to business growth.

Your Toolkit for Digital Dominance

Important Skills to Become an E-commerce Marketing Manager

To excel as an e-commerce marketing manager, you need a diverse set of skills that blend strategic thinking with hands-on execution. Firstly, a strong grasp of digital marketing channels is non-negotiable. This includes seo, sem, social media, and email marketing.

You must also possess excellent analytical skills to interpret data from various sources like google analytics. Understanding conversion rates, customer acquisition costs, and other key metrics is vital. This enables you to make informed decisions.

Furthermore, project management abilities are crucial, as you will often juggle multiple campaigns and initiatives simultaneously. You need to organize tasks, manage timelines, and coordinate with different teams effectively. This ensures smooth operations.

Communication skills, both written and verbal, are paramount for an e-commerce marketing manager. You will need to articulate strategies, present results, and collaborate with team members and external partners. Clear communication drives success.

Finally, adaptability and a continuous learning mindset are essential in the fast-paced e-commerce landscape. New technologies and market trends emerge constantly. You must stay updated and be willing to experiment with new approaches.

The Interview Hot Seat: Preparing for Success

Facing an interview for an e-commerce marketing manager role can be daunting, but thorough preparation will boost your confidence significantly. You should research the company extensively before your interview. Understand their products, target audience, and recent marketing campaigns.

Moreover, anticipate common behavioral questions and prepare concise, impactful answers using the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result). This helps you illustrate your experience effectively. Think about specific achievements in previous roles.

You should also be ready to discuss your portfolio or examples of past successful campaigns. Highlight your contributions and the measurable results you achieved. This provides tangible evidence of your capabilities.

Remember to formulate thoughtful questions to ask the interviewer at the end. This demonstrates your engagement and genuine interest in the role and the company. It also helps you gather crucial information.

Practicing your answers out loud can also be incredibly beneficial. It helps you refine your responses and ensures you sound confident and articulate. You will feel more prepared and less nervous on the actual day.

Question 6

How do you measure the success of your e-commerce marketing efforts?
Answer:
I measure success using a range of kpis including conversion rates, customer acquisition cost (cac), return on ad spend (roas), and customer lifetime value (cltv). I use tools like google analytics and crm systems to track these metrics. This ensures our efforts are impactful.

Question 7

What is your strategy for increasing conversion rates on an e-commerce website?
Answer:
My strategy involves a/b testing various elements like product page layouts, calls-to-action, and checkout processes. I also focus on optimizing site speed, improving product photography, and implementing clear value propositions. This creates a seamless user experience.

Question 16

How do you approach A/B testing in your campaigns?
Answer:
I approach a/b testing systematically, starting with a clear hypothesis and focusing on one variable at a time, such as headline, cta, or image. I run tests until statistical significance is reached, then implement the winning variation. This optimizes performance incrementally.
